The Celestial Ballad: The Guardian's Penance

In the celestial realm, where the sky was painted in hues of twilight and the stars whispered secrets of the universe, there lived an angel named Luminara. Her wings were as white as the purest snow, and her eyes held the clarity of a pristine spring. She was a guardian, a protector of the divine, sworn to the purity of her celestial duties. Yet, in the heart of her was a love that contradicted the very essence of her being—a love for a human, a mere mortal named Aelion.

Aelion was a warrior of the mortal realm, known for his courage and his unyielding spirit. It was during a battle between the celestial and mortal realms that Luminara first glimpsed his valor. The clash of steel against celestial might left her breathless, and as the dust settled, she found herself face to face with Aelion, his gaze filled with a sorrow that mirrored her own.

Their connection was instant, a bond forged in the crucible of their shared struggle. Yet, it was a connection that could never be consummated. The Celestial Ballad, an ancient and sacred text, dictated that angels and mortals could not love one another. To do so was to risk the very fabric of the heavens.

Despite the forbidden nature of their love, Luminara and Aelion found solace in each other's presence. They would meet in secret, in the quiet moments between battles, where their laughter and whispered secrets filled the air like a balm to their souls. But their time together was precious and fleeting, always under the watchful eyes of the celestial guardians.

The Angel's Contest of Purity was an annual event, a trial by which celestial beings proved their dedication to their duties. This year, Luminara was chosen to participate. It was a contest she was obligated to enter, but her heart was heavy with the knowledge that it would bring her and Aelion closer to the day when their love would be tested beyond measure.

The contest was a series of trials, each more daunting than the last. Luminara faced the test of her purity, her loyalty, and her strength. But the greatest challenge was yet to come. In the final trial, she would be asked to choose between her celestial duties and the love she held for Aelion.

As the day of the contest approached, Luminara found herself at a crossroads. She could continue to deny her love and maintain her celestial purity, or she could accept her heart's desires and risk everything for Aelion. The choice was hers alone, and it would determine the fate of their love.

The day of the contest arrived, and the celestial realm buzzed with anticipation. Luminara stood at the center of the stage, her heart pounding in her chest. The judges, a council of celestial elders, watched her with keen eyes. The air was charged with tension, the weight of the heavens resting upon her shoulders.

The first trial was a test of her purity. She was stripped of her celestial attire and left to face the void. It was a trial of both body and soul, and Luminara held her ground. Her resolve was unwavering, and she emerged from the trial with her purity intact.

The second trial was a test of her loyalty. She was asked to choose between the celestial realm and Aelion. As she stood before the judges, her gaze met Aelion's across the vast expanse of the celestial plane. The choice was clear, and with a heavy heart, she declared her loyalty to him.

The final trial was the most perilous of all. It was a test of her strength, a battle against the dark forces that sought to tear apart the celestial and mortal realms. Luminara fought valiantly, her wings a whirlwind of white as she confronted the darkness.

In the climax of the battle, Luminara was forced to make the ultimate sacrifice. She chose to protect Aelion and the mortal realm, sacrificing her celestial status and her place among the divine. With a final, desperate strike, she banished the darkness, but at the cost of her own existence.

As the celestial realm came to terms with the loss of one of their own, Aelion was left to mourn the angel who had given everything for love. He found solace in the memory of their love, a love that transcended the boundaries of realm and species.

In the aftermath of the contest, the celestial and mortal realms were at peace. The Angel's Contest of Purity had been won, not by Luminara, but by the love she had given freely. Her sacrifice was a testament to the power of love and the courage it takes to stand by one's heart, even in the face of celestial judgment.

Aelion stood atop a hill, watching the sunset. In the distance, he saw a silhouette of an angel, wings spread wide, soaring towards the heavens. It was Luminara, her soul freed from the constraints of her celestial role, now a guardian of the celestial realms once more.

And so, the celestial and mortal realms coexisted in peace, their bond strengthened by the love of Luminara and Aelion. The Angel's Contest of Purity had been won, and with it, a new chapter had begun—a chapter written in the celestial ballad of love, purity, and redemption.
